Title: Opening Ports On TP Link Archer C5400 Tri-Band MU-MIMO Wireless AC5400 Router?
Post by: rockphantom on July 02, 2017, 04:51:12 PM
Does anyone else out there own the TP Link Archer C5400 Tri-Band MU-MIMO Wireless AC5400 Gigabit Router?
I am using it with a Windows 10 machine and am unable to properly open ports for torrenting. I use qBitorrent 3.3.13 as my client. I also use PeerBlock while torrenting.
I have plenty of experience properly opening ports on routers in the past. However, I can't figure out how to properly open ports on the Archer C5400 Tri-Band MU-MIMO Wireless AC5400 Gigabit Router.
I have properly opened the correct port using the guide on portforward.com: https://portforward.com/tp-link/archer-c5400/ and I've also opened the correct port in the Windows 10 Firewall. I am still firewalled on DIME and TTD (the only torrent sites I frequent).

Could PeerBlock be causing the issue?

The PortForward website is the gold standard for setting up routers and computers, so the information there is solid.  At the risk of stating the obvious, have you set up your computer so it has a static IP address? > https://portforward.com/networking/staticip.htm (https://portforward.com/networking/staticip.htm)   When I first started torrenting years ago, I was stymied until I did that.  Everything fell into place afterwards.

Once you think you have it done then test the port at http://www.yougetsignal.com/tools/open-ports/ and make sure it is open
